On 22/01/2021 11.58, Philippe Mathieu-Daudé wrote:
Users might want to enable all features, without realizing some
features have negative effect. Mention the TCI feature is slow
and experimental, hoping it will be selected knowingly.

I'd prefer if we could keep the "TCI" in there ... I remember having grep'ed for "tci" in the help output in the past, so I think it would be good to keep the TLA here. Maybe just put "TCI, slow" in the parantheses and omit "experimental"?
